发明名称 VEHICLE ELECTRICAL DISTRIBUTION SYSTEM STABILIZATION
摘要 A transfer device for energy in a motor vehicle is designed for connection to a first vehicle electrical distribution system and a second vehicle electrical distribution system, which each comprise an associated energy store. In this case, the transfer device comprises a first sampling device for determining that the two energy stores have been filled sufficiently, a second sampling device for detecting an energy withdrawal from one of the vehicle electrical distribution systems, and a DC-to-DC converter for transferring energy between the vehicle electrical distribution systems. In addition, a control device is provided which is designed, in an automatic mode to control a transfer of energy from one of the vehicle electrical distribution systems into the other vehicle electrical distribution system on the basis of the signals of the sampling devices when energy is withdrawn from the other vehicle electrical distribution system.

主权项 1. A transfer device (155) for energy in a motor vehicle (105), for connection to a first vehicle electrical distribution system (110) and a second vehicle electrical distribution system (120), which each comprise an associated energy store (115, 125), wherein the transfer device (155) comprises the following: a first sampling device (175) for determining that the two energy stores (115, 125) have been filled sufficiently; a second sampling device (180) for detecting an energy withdrawal from one of the vehicle electrical distribution systems (110, 120); a DC-to-DC converter (160) for transferring energy between the vehicle electrical distribution systems (110, 120); a control device (150), which is designed, in an automatic mode (230) to control a transfer of energy from one of the vehicle electrical distribution systems (110, 120) into the other vehicle electrical distribution system (120, 110) on the basis of the signals of the sampling devices (175, 180) when energy is withdrawn from the other vehicle electrical distribution system (120, 110).
